Youth arrested for producing fake job letter at Swasthya Bhawan

Bidhannagar City Police arrested a youth on charges of using a fake call-letter while facing a job interview at Swasthya Bhawan – the office of department of health and family welfare.

The accused person, identified as Tanka Burman, came from North Dinajpur to face an interview for a job in Group D post.

At the beginning of the interview with Burman, the interviewers suspected that Burman issued a fake call-letter. "After examining the call-letter, interviewers had no doubt that it was a fake call-letter and informed the matter to the police," said a police officer.

Cops from Bidhannagar Electronics Complex police station arrested the person. "The accused confessed that he issued fake call-letters to get the job. Burman also confessed that he was not selected for the interview, so he had to make a fake call-letter," the officer added.

However, the investigators believed that Burman took help from some other people to make the fake call-letter. "There are some other people involved in this case. They probably took money from Burman before making a fake call-letter for him," the officer further said.
